Meals: Dinner - Day 3DAY 3, Tuesday - Berlin City TourTue, Aug 04, 2026Begin the morning with a guided tour. View the Reichstag building where the German Parliament is housed since 1894. Continue to the famous Brandenburg Gate, that once represented the separation of the city between East and West Berlin. Since the Berlin Wall came down in 1989, it is now a symbol of German unity, along with Checkpoint Charlie, the controversial crossing point. Drive along elegant Unter den Linden Boulevard and Kurfurstendamm, one of the city's most famous avenues and continue past the German State Opera House and the Baroque Deutscher Dom (German Cathedral) built in the 1700s. Meals: Breakfast - Day 4DAY 4, Wednesday - Walking Tour of DresdenWed, Aug 05, 2026Known for its magnificent art treasures and Baroque architecture, much of this city was destroyed during the war but has been restored to its former glory, including the Royal Palace and its museum, with treasures dating back to the 1720s. The guided walking tour includes such sites as Zwinger Palace, the Semper Opera and the signature landmark of Dresden, the Frauenkirche, the Church of Our Lady, totally rebuilt from rubble. Meals: Breakfast - Day 6DAY 6, Friday - Prague City TourFri, Aug 07, 2026Your morning tour of Prague includes a visit to the 1000-year-old Hradcany Castle grounds, former residence of the Bohemian kings. Admire magnificent views of the Charles Bridge and Lesser Town below and see the elegant courtyards, St. George Basilica and the St. Vitus Cathedral. Continue to the Jewish Quarter, and the Old Town Square to view the world-famous Astronomical Clock and the Town Hall. Meals: Breakfast, Dinner - Day 9DAY 9, Monday - Regensburg City TourMon, Aug 10, 2026This morning, explore Regensburg, one of Germany's largest and best-preserved medieval cities, designated a UNESCO World Heritage Site. The guided walking tour highlights the city's stunning architecture as you view the Old Town Hall, Dom St. Peter and the Porta Praetoria, gateway to an ancient Roman fort built in 179 AD. Marvel at beautiful churches and one of the oldest stone bridges crossing the Danube. Know Before You Book - High & Low Water
European river cruising has gained in popularity for very good reason. It's a relaxing and convenient way to experience Europe while enjoying the comfort of a deluxe ship. However, before making the decision to reserve your vacation, please be aware of potential conditions which may impact your cruise. While most of the time river cruises operate exactly as planned, weather conditions may result in high or low water levels which impact a ship's itinerary and, on occasion, render a ship unable to sail at all. On very rare occasions, other events such as heavy fog, a damaged lock, or an incapacitated vessel blocking the river, may impact a sailing. These events typically occur with little or no notice. In the event that a cruise is partially or completely impacted, the itinerary will be operated by deluxe motor coach, accompanied by a Tour Manager, with overnights in hotels. When the option exists, the operator will "swap ships" with another vessel sailing in the opposite direction, retaining the sailing experience. Crew, ship and cabin configuration may differ. The itinerary will include as many of the originally scheduled sightseeing features as possible, considering the travel time and distances required, as well as meals. While it is not possible to recreate the more leisurely comforts of sailings, we will endeavor to provide a comparable itinerary.
